The **Udyam registration certificate** is the final output of the MSME registration process. It is a unique, QR-code-enabled document that proves your business's legal standing as a small or medium enterprise. It is called a certificate because it certifies that your business has self-declared its investment and turnover, and those have been verified against the government's tax databases. This makes it a foundational document for 'Ease of Doing Business' in India.

You can verify any **udyam registration certificate** by visiting the official portal and entering the registration number. This transparency helps in weeding out fake businesses and ensures that the benefits go to the right entrepreneurs.

Can I add more NIC codes after I get the certificate?
Yes, the certificate is dynamic. You can add or remove activities and a new version of the certificate will be generated.
What should I do if I lose my Udyam mobile number?
You will need to file a specialized request with the DIC or seek professional help to update the mobile number in the master database.
Does the certificate show my turnover?
The certificate shows your 'Enterprise Type' which is based on your turnover, but it doesn't print the exact rupee value of your sales.
Can a shopkeeper get an Udyam certificate?
Yes, retail and wholesale shopkeepers are now eligible to obtain the Udyam certificate for Priority Sector Lending benefits.
